Tile floor repair services involve fixing damaged or worn tiles to restore the appearance and functionality of a tiled surface. This process can include replacing broken or cracked tiles, regrouting to eliminate mold or deterioration, and leveling uneven flooring. Skilled service providers assess the extent of damage, carefully remove damaged tiles, and install new ones that match the existing pattern and style. The goal is to create a seamless, durable surface that looks as good as new, helping to prolong the lifespan of the flooring and maintain the property's overall appeal.
Many common issues can be addressed through tile floor repair. Cracks, chips, or broken tiles often result from impacts, shifting foundations, or age-related wear. Grout lines can become stained, cracked, or crumbly over time, leading to water infiltration and further damage. Uneven tiles or loose sections may cause safety hazards or make cleaning difficult. Repairing these problems not only improves the appearance but also helps prevent more extensive damage that could lead to the need for complete replacement, saving property owners time and money in the long run.

The overview below groups typical Tile Floor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- minor tile floor repairs typically cost between $200 and $600 for many routine jobs. These projects often involve fixing a few damaged tiles or small sections, and most local contractors handle these within this range. Larger or more complex repairs can push costs higher, but many projects stay in the middle of this band.
Moderate Restoration - restoring or replacing larger sections of tile flooring usually falls between $600 and $2,000. This range covers mid-sized areas or multiple repairs across a room, with many jobs completing within this budget. Projects that involve extensive matching or intricate work may reach the higher end of this range.
Full Floor Replacement - replacing an entire tile floor can range from $2,000 to $5,000 or more, depending on the size and tile type. Many full replacements fall into the lower to middle part of this spectrum, while larger, more detailed installations can push costs higher. Local service providers can provide estimates based on specific project details.
Complex or Custom Projects - highly detailed, custom, or extensive tile flooring projects can exceed $5,000, especially if premium materials or intricate patterns are involved. These projects are less common and often require specialized craftsmanship, with costs varying widely based on scope and materials.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
